Output c77bdfa1934ab53869c2ce1dbcaf5a884ed52a08b539e084fc72bca41304bee3:12

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77e3f0d0c20d6595a35480a6789b9d941bd05c93 OP_EQUAL
address
3CcwPy6mBS2hVauvxS2scbjA7ypfs3Hm5c
transaction
c77bdfa1934ab53869c2ce1dbcaf5a884ed52a08b539e084fc72bca41304bee3
spent
true